Wheel caps are essential vehicle components, serving aesthetic and functional purposes. These small but vital accessories can enhance the appearance of wheels and protect the hub assembly, lug nuts, and bearings from dirt and debris.
Plastic injection moulded wheel caps, often referred to as centre caps, are circular or dome-shaped covers that fit over the centre of a vehicle's wheel, covering the hub assembly. They are primarily used to enhance the aesthetic appeal of the vehicle's wheels, but they also offer functional benefits.
Aesthetics: Wheel caps come in various designs and can be customised to match the vehicle's style or branding. They provide a finished, polished look to the wheels, making them visually appealing and uniform with the rest of the vehicle.
Protection: Wheel caps protect the hub assembly, lug nuts, and wheel bearings from dust, moisture, and road debris. This helps extend the life of these components.
Safety: Wheel caps also contribute to vehicle safety by preventing foreign objects from entering the wheel assembly, which could potentially lead to accidents or damage.
Design and Prototyping:
The process begins with the wheel cap's design, taking into consideration the vehicle's brand and style.
CAD (Computer-Aided Design) software is used to create a 3D model of the cap.
Prototypes may be developed to test the design for fit and aesthetics before scale production begins.
Material Selection:
The choice of plastic material for wheel caps is crucial. It needs to be durable, lightweight, and cost-effective. Common materials for injection moulders include ABS (Acrylonitrile Butadiene Styrene) and polypropylene.
Mould Manufacturing:
A mould tool is created from the CAD design before the tool impressions are machined out of steel or aluminium. The finished injection mould consists of two halves, allowing molten plastic to be injected into the space between them.
Depending on the size and dimensions of the component, a multi-cavity mould may be preferred. A multi-cavity mould creates multiple components per moulding cycle due to being manufactured with multiple identical mould cavities. Moulding, for example, six, eight, or twelve products per cycle, increases efficiencies, and cost savings can be achieved.
The selected plastic material is heated until it reaches a molten state within the barrel of an injection moulding machine and is then injected into the mould cavity at high pressure.
The plastic takes the shape of the mould cavity and cools down, solidifying into the desired wheel cap shape.
Ejection:
The moulded wheel caps are then ejected from the mould, usually by some form of automatic means. This could be ejector pins in the mould construction or via an external automation setup.
Quality Control:
Each wheel cap undergoes inspection for defects, including dimensional accuracy, surface finish, and colour consistency.
Post Processing:
Additional processes like painting, chrome plating, or other finishings can be applied to the wheel caps for an improved finished aesthetic.
Packaging and Distribution:
The finished wheel caps are packaged and prepared for distribution to automotive manufacturers, dealers, or retailers.

Wheel caps are mostly used for aesthetics and improved safety by OEM brands and are manufactured in very high volumes via injection moulding.
However, there is also a growing market within the modified sector to personalise wheel designs via wheel cap replacements. Many different vehicle types utilise wheel caps, such as cars, trucks, motorbikes, trailers and even farming equipment, industrial vehicles and more.
